About the leak

Mitchell - Are you only getting the water when the waves are breaking? Little to no water on flat lakes or inside the harbor? If so - it is likely the hatches. I had the same issue w/my Cobra Tourer. The Cobra hull is thinner than some others, but the hatches are more rigid. The flexing of the hull when the hatches don't allow gaps between them. Plus it can leak from the bolt holes for the hatch locks. One way to check - put a little water in the hull at home, then soapy water around the sealed hatches and locks. Remove the drain plug in the bow and blow in compressed air. You will see bubbles from hatches that leak or water coming out of the hull if the there is a leak.

It you discover any of these, feel free to shoot me a PM and I might be able to provide you w/some ideas for repairs.
